Abstract
A network system can receive a set of multi-user request data corresponding to a multi-user request for service for a set of users that includes a first user. The set of multi-user request data can indicate a common start location for the set of users and identification information for at least the first user of the set of users. In response to receiving the set of multi-user request data from the requesting user device, the system transmits a first set of data to a first user device of the first user to cause the first user device to prompt the first user to input a destination location for the first user. The system then identifies a set of service providers to fulfill the multi-user request for service for the set of users.
